Hudson Knox has been sent to Germany by his pack to research the last known location Nazi boat that caused the Night of 1000 Deaths. But in the Arolsen Archives, he discovers that Neo-Nazi warlocks and a brilliant Egyptology grad student, Yazmin Hunter-Blake, are hunting the same information. Yazmin is hunting for evidence of a secret treasure trove of Egyptian artifacts hidden in the tomb of a Crusader knight, but finds her research attempts stymied by the detestably handsome Hudson Knox. When warlocks attack, revealing the Supernatural world to Yazmin, she is forced to team up with Hudson to trace the path of Sir Barnabas—the first warlock and Crusader knight—through Germany to his final resting place. Hudson knows that discovering the secrets of warlock magic could change everything for the Supernaturals, but he is still determined to protect the unflappable and irresistible Yazmin. But with warlocks on their trail, Hudson and Yazmin might end up sharing the knight’s tomb unless they can figure out the ancient secrets that activate the magic within.
